Former Chelsea star Michael Ballack has questioned the transfer interest in Bayer Leverkusen whiz Kai Havertz.
Real Madrid, Liverpool and Manchester United are among clubs linked with the Germany international.
But Ballack told Sport1: "One thing is clear - Havertz is not yet a finished player.
"That is not meant negatively, but I still see potential for improvement in his personality development and body language.
"But that is completely normal at his age. As a captain, he first has to learn to deal with this responsibility.
"His style of play has always been very carefree. If he ever lost the ball, he was allowed to stop. With a top club, everything will be more difficult and will no longer be accepted.
"He must and will be aware that he has an exceptional position in Leverkusen. He should ask himself now, 'How long do I want to have this? How long do I enjoy it? Or will I take on the next challenge with even greater demands on my game this summer?'."
